久久精品人人爽,华人av在线,亚洲性视频网站,欧美专区一二三

python驗證碼校驗程序怎么實現

262次閱讀
沒有評論

共計 716 個字符,預計需要花費 2 分鐘才能閱讀完成。

要實現一個驗證碼校驗程序,可以按照以下步驟進行:

  1. 生成驗證碼:使用 Python 的隨機數生成函數(如 random 模塊)生成一串隨機的驗證碼字符串,并將其展示給用戶。

  2. 輸入驗證碼:提示用戶輸入驗證碼,并使用 input() 函數獲取用戶輸入的字符串。

  3. 校驗驗證碼:將用戶輸入的驗證碼與生成的驗證碼進行比較,判斷是否一致。可以使用 if 語句來進行判斷,如果一致,則輸出校驗成功的提示信息;否則,輸出校驗失敗的提示信息。

以下是一個簡單的示例代碼:

import random

# 生成驗證碼
def generate_captcha(length):
    captcha = ''
    for _ in range(length):
        captcha += random.choice('ab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XYZ')
    return captcha

# 主程序
def main():
    captcha = generate_captcha(4)
    print(" 驗證碼:", captcha)
    user_input = input(" 請輸入驗證碼:")
    
    if user_input.lower() == captcha.lower():
        print(" 驗證碼校驗成功!")
    else:
        print(" 驗證碼校驗失敗!")

if __name__ == '__main__':
    main()

運行程序后,會生成一個 4 位的驗證碼,并提示用戶輸入驗證碼。用戶輸入后,程序會進行校驗,并輸出相應的提示信息。請注意,這只是一個簡單的示例,實際情況中,可能需要更復雜的驗證碼生成和校驗邏輯。

丸趣 TV 網 – 提供最優質的資源集合!

正文完
 
丸趣
版權聲明:本站原創文章,由 丸趣 2024-02-05發表,共計716字。
轉載說明:除特殊說明外本站除技術相關以外文章皆由網絡搜集發布,轉載請注明出處。
評論(沒有評論)
主站蜘蛛池模板: 高州市| 彭水| 库伦旗| 大兴区| 云霄县| 长武县| 墨脱县| 筠连县| 隆回县| 宜兴市| 张北县| 阿拉尔市| 桂林市| 原平市| 德钦县| 溆浦县| 长泰县| 成都市| 阳曲县| 白河县| 西乌珠穆沁旗| 宿松县| 桃江县| 石屏县| 尼勒克县| 莱州市| 南部县| 渭南市| 大同县| 鹿泉市| 彭水| 特克斯县| 榆社县| 建宁县| 苍南县| 法库县| 龙里县| 大竹县| 怀安县| 五指山市| 漳平市|